So there are a ton of companies working on different types of cortisol sensors. I signed up for a case study with one of the companies in California (not yet admitted) and I'm currently working on an open source project that will function as the data layer between a cortisol sensor and an intravenous cortisol delivery system.
The future plan for this technology (it doesn't exist yet, hence the alternative science tag) is for Addison's patients to have a Continuous Subcutaneous Hydrocortisone Infusion (CSHI), similar to how diabetes patients with an insulin pump today. This python library that I'm building is meant to help calculate and coordinate the micro dose of cortisol that Addison patients need during stress events to stay more even and have fewer cortisol spikes, thus improving out quality of life.
